quote: Originally posted by Forster
Actually, I don't mind some of the adjustments, but something like coal and iron are not rare on earth. Now aluminum, diamonds and uranium, those should be rare. In all the C3C games I've started so far, diamonds seem to be plentiful, much more so than iron. Now that is a wierd twist of fate.
Where do you make the changes? Which file? |
You need to use the editor. It is called Civ3ConquestsEdit.exe and is in the main Conquests directory. Once it is opened, use it to open conquests.biq, again in the main Conquests directory. This is the rules file for the game.
Then go to Rules, Edit, Natural Resources. Choose the resource you want from the dropbox, and increase the "Appearance Ratio". This is what controls how many of each resource appears in randomly generated maps. You can generate a map in the editor to see how much difference your changes make by choosing Map, Generate Map. I have only seen a way to change the Appearance Ratios of Luxury and Strategic resources, not bonus ones (like wheat).
When you are happy with how many of each resource turns up, save the file as preferably something different to conquests.biq. Better still, save the original file elsewhere before you do all this so you can return to the original if you want. To start a game with the new appearance ratios, make sure the old .biq file is safe in another folder, and change the name of your new altered .biq file to conquests.biq Then, when you start a new game, the rules will reflect the changes you have made.
I really urge everyone to play around with the editor - you can actually fix a lot of little things like this that you want to fix - no patch needed! However it does not give a solution to the gpt, FP or RCP bugs.
